my book says 108-132 in lbs.
 






a good rule of thumb on any tranny pan is 100 in lbs -- also always reuse the metal/rubber gaskets - don't use the paper thin ones that come in the little "kits".

-Drew
 






I have my torque wrench set to 10 ft. lbs for both the valve body bolts, and the pan. The 3 valve body bolts that hold the VB together are about 70 in lbs. Blee1099 said that it would be 9-11 ft. lbs. 10 ft. lbs is a middle torque rating. Always follow the correct torque specifications on sensitive parts so that you don't strip anything.
